vscode编码错误怎么办

worktile 其他 44

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    问题描述:如何解决VSCode的编码错误?

    问题解答:在使用VSCode的过程中,有时我们可能会遇到编码错误的情况,这会导致代码无法正常运行或者显示乱码。下面我将介绍一些常见的编码错误及解决方法,帮助您解决这个问题。

    1. 设置文件编码:
    在VSCode的底部状态栏可以看到当前文件的编码格式,通常默认是UTF-8。如果你的代码有编码错误,可以尝试手动设置正确的编码格式,具体操作如下:
    点击底部状态栏的编码格式名称,弹出选择框,选择正确的编码格式即可。

    2. 转换文件编码:
    如果你的代码文件已经打开,并且显示乱码或者无法正常运行,可以尝试转换文件编码格式,具体操作如下:
    – 点击文件菜单,选择“文件另存为…”;
    – 在另存为对话框中,选择正确的编码格式,点击保存。

    3. 检查文件头部注释:
    在一些编程语言中,文件头部的注释可能包含声明当前文件所使用的编码格式。如果文件编码错误,可能需要检查文件头部注释的编码声明是否正确。一般来说,编码声明以“#”或“//”开头,后面跟着编码格式的说明。

    4. 使用插件辅助:
    VSCode提供了很多插件来辅助解决编码问题。可以通过扩展插件市场搜索相关插件,安装并使用它们来帮助解决编码错误。

    总结:在使用VSCode的过程中,遇到编码错误是比较常见的问题,但是不用担心,可以通过设置文件编码、转换文件编码、检查文件头部注释以及使用插件辅助等方法来解决这个问题。希望以上方法可以帮助到您。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    如果在使用VSCode时遇到编码错误,可以采取以下几种方法来解决问题:

    1. 检查文件编码:首先要确定文件的实际编码方式是否正确,特别是当打开或编辑非英文字符时。在VSCode的右下角状态栏可以看到当前文件的编码格式,点击该位置可以切换不同的编码方式。确保选择正确的编码格式,比如UTF-8或GBK。

    2. 更改默认编码设置:可以在VSCode的设置中更改默认的文件编码格式,以确保每次打开新文件时都使用正确的编码方式。点击菜单栏的“文件”->“首选项”->“设置”,在设置窗口的搜索框中输入“files.encoding”,然后选择适当的编码方式。

    3. 更改工作区编码:如果只有特定的文件或项目出现编码问题,可以单独更改工作区的编码设置。在VSCode的左侧资源管理器中,右键点击对应的文件夹,选择“生成工作区配置文件”并保存,然后在生成的“.vscode”文件夹下的“settings.json”文件中添加以下代码:
    “`
    “files.encoding”: “utf8”
    “`
    将编码格式更改为需要的格式。

    4. 使用插件:VSCode提供了一些插件来处理不同的编码问题。可以在VSCode的扩展商店中搜索并安装适合的插件,例如“Code Runner”插件可以支持不同编码格式的运行。

    5. 打开文件时进行编码检测:可以在VSCode的设置中打开“files.autoGuessEncoding”选项,以便在打开文件时自动检测编码方式并进行正确转换。

    总之,VSCode提供了丰富的功能和设置选项来解决编码错误问题。根据实际情况可以采取相应的方法来解决编码错误,确保文件可以正常打开和编辑。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在VSCode中遇到编码错误时,可以采取以下几个方法来解决问题:

    1. 检查文件编码:首先确认文件的编码格式是否正确,常见的编码格式有UTF-8、GBK等。可以通过VSCode的底部状态栏来查看当前文件的编码格式,如果显示为乱码或者不符合预期的编码格式,那么就需要进行编码转换。

    2. 修改文本文件编码:如果需要修改文本文件的编码格式,可以通过以下步骤进行操作:
    – 点击VSCode的“文件(File)”菜单,选择“首选项(Preferences)” -> “设置(Settings)”。
    – 在弹出的设置面板左上角的搜索框中,输入“files.encoding”,找到“Files: Encoding”设置项。
    – 在右侧的“值”中选择需要的编码格式,比如UTF-8。
    – 关闭设置面板后,VSCode会自动将文件保存为指定编码格式。

    3. 修改默认文本文件编码:如果想要设置VSCode的默认文本文件编码格式,可以按照以下步骤进行操作:
    – 点击VSCode的“文件(File)”菜单,选择“首选项(Preferences)” -> “设置(Settings)”。
    – 在弹出的设置面板左上角的搜索框中,输入“files.defaultLanguage”。
    – 在右侧的“值”中选择需要的编码格式,比如UTF-8。
    – 关闭设置面板后,以后新创建的文本文件就会使用指定的编码格式。

    4. 使用插件:如果上述方法无法解决问题,可以尝试安装一些相关的插件来解决编码错误。VSCode市场中有一些插件可以进行编码转换或者自动检测编码格式。

    5. 使用命令行工具:除了VSCode内部的方法,还可以使用命令行工具来进行编码转换。比如使用iconv命令可以将文件从一种编码格式转换为另一种编码格式。

    总结:
    通过检查文件编码、修改文本文件编码、修改默认文本文件编码、使用插件或命令行工具等方法,可以解决VSCode中的编码错误问题。根据具体情况选择适合的方法来解决问题。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部